Uploaded image for project: 'OpenShift Bugs'
  1. OpenShift Bugs
  2. OCPBUGS-56099

guided tour causing regression in dynamic plugins testing

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Not a Bug
    • Icon: Undefined Undefined
    • None
    • 4.19.0, 4.19
    • Dev Console
    • Quality / Stability / Reliability
    • False
    • Hide

      None

      Show
      None
    • None
    • Critical
    • Yes
    • None
    • None
    • Rejected
    • ODC Sprint 3275
    • 1
    • None
    • None
    • None
    • None
    • None
    • None
    • None

      Description of problem:

      Visual regression caused by guidedTour setting. Popup shows for kubeadmin user and regression testing in cypress is broken from there. We test service mesh plugin (OSSMC) and all tests are stuck here. 
      
      For more details, please see slack thread https://redhat-internal.slack.com/archives/CH76YSYSC/p1746632873601579

      Version-Release number of selected component (if applicable):

      4.19

      How reproducible:

      All regression on top of OCP, potentially Interop testing, dynamic plugins ...

      Steps to Reproduce:

          1. provision testing cluster
          2. login into cluster (kubeadmin or we use other IDP)
          3. see the popup
          

      Actual results:

          popup blocking regression

      Expected results:

          popup being disabled, even in non controllable environments 

      Additional info:

      1) We can modify login flow to ignore this element (as suggested) 
      - this is expensive, generally you cause regression and downstream teams consuming OCP console needs to fix that
      2) create a dummy login for a new user and disable the tour via OC command (see slack thread) 
      - sounds much more reasonable, but see above and we might get into trouble in specific environments where we cannot control such a setting 
      
      Open to discussion 
       

              viraj-1 Vikram Raj
              rhn-support-pmarek Pavel Marek
              None
              Matej Kralik, Pavel Marek
              YaDan Pei YaDan Pei
              None
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

                Created:
                Updated:
                Resolved: